Manama, September 29 /BNA/ His Majesty King Hamad bin Isa Al Khalifa, the esteemed King of the country, may God protect and preserve him, issued Decree No. (61) of 2025 to restructure the General Organization for Social Insurance, based on the presentation of the Minister of Finance and National Economy and after the approval of the Cabinet, stating:
Article One
The General Organization for Social Insurance shall be restructured as follows:
Board of Directors, followed by:
Chief Executive Officer, followed by:
First: Actuarial Studies and Risks Department.
Second: Legal Affairs and Inspection Department.
Third: Communication and Awareness Department.
Fourth: Deputy CEO for Insurance Affairs (with the rank of Assistant Undersecretary), followed by:
1- Registration and Subscriptions Department.
2- Insured Services Department.
Fifth: Deputy CEO for Operations Affairs (with the rank of Assistant Undersecretary), followed by:
1- Financial Operations Department.
2- Resources and Services Department.
3- Insurance Information Department.
Sixth: Deputy CEO for Retirees Affairs (with the rank of Assistant Undersecretary), followed by:
1- Entitlements and Retirees Pensions Department.
2- Retirees Services Department.
Article Two
Decree No. (79) of 2019 organizing the General Organization for Social Insurance is hereby repealed.
Article Three
The Minister of Finance and National Economy shall implement this decree, which shall come into effect from the date of issuance and be published in the Official Gazette.
